$175 - $600
Single room $175–$275. Whole house $400–$600. The final range reflects the East Orlando pickup path and material.

Local material routing
Materials and disposal planning
Material planning matters on carpet removal jobs in East Orlando. Dry carpet, wet carpet, padding, and tack strip are handled differently for loading and disposal. Anything unusually heavy, wet, hazardous, or restricted should be called out in the photos before pickup so it is not mixed into the wrong load. This service does not include subfloor repairs; flag those items early so the right next step can be identified before the visit.
